The Government is set to cut billions of dollars from spending at the upcoming budget as a cost-saving measure in these tight financial conditions.
But what if there was a way to raise more revenue from existing industries?
Analysis from the Herald has looked at the ‘black market’ or the informal economy – the industries dominated by cash in hand methods of payment that pass by the tax system.
NZ Herald Head of Newsroom Data Chris Knox has run the numbers, and joins us today on The Front Page to talk through how much the country is missing out on.
